/** * MCP sampling instrumentation utility. * * Wraps an MCP client's sampling handler to capture nested LLM calls * (sampling/createMessage requests) made during tool execution. * The captured data can be reported as child generation spans. */ export type SamplingCallData = { model_id?: string; input_tokens?: number; output_tokens?: number; reasoning_tokens?: number; cached_input_tokens?: number; duration_ms?: number; }; export type McpSamplingHandler = ( request: McpSamplingRequest, ) => Promise<McpSamplingResponse>; export type McpSamplingRequest = { method: "sampling/createMessage"; params: { messages: unknown[]; modelPreferences?: { hints?: { name?: string }[] }; maxTokens?: number; [key: string]: unknown; }; }; export type McpSamplingResponse = { model?: string; content: unknown; usage?: { inputTokens?: number; outputTokens?: number; promptTokens?: number; completionTokens?: number; reasoningTokens?: number; cachedInputTokens?: number; }; [key: string]: unknown; }; /** * Wraps an MCP sampling handler to intercept and measure sampling calls. * * @param handler - The original sampling handler from the MCP client * @param onSamplingCall - Callback invoked with metrics for each sampling call * @returns A wrapped handler that transparently captures sampling metrics * * @example * ```ts * const samplingCalls: SamplingCallData[] = []; * const wrapped = wrapSamplingHandler( * originalHandler, * (data) => samplingCalls.push(data), * ); * // Use `wrapped` as the MCP client's sampling handler * // After tool execution, `samplingCalls` contains metrics for all nested LLM calls * ``` */ export function wrapSamplingHandler( handler: McpSamplingHandler, onSamplingCall: (data: SamplingCallData) => void, ): McpSamplingHandler { return async (request) => { const startTime = Date.now(); const response = await handler(request); const durationMs = Date.now() - startTime; const modelId = response.model ?? request.params.modelPreferences?.hints?.[0]?.name; const inputTokens = response.usage?.inputTokens ?? response.usage?.promptTokens; const outputTokens = response.usage?.outputTokens ?? response.usage?.completionTokens; const reasoningTokens = response.usage?.reasoningTokens; const cachedInputTokens = response.usage?.cachedInputTokens; onSamplingCall({ ...(modelId ? { model_id: modelId } : undefined), ...(inputTokens != null ? { input_tokens: inputTokens } : undefined), ...(outputTokens != null ? { output_tokens: outputTokens } : undefined), ...(reasoningTokens != null ? { reasoning_tokens: reasoningTokens } : undefined), ...(cachedInputTokens != null ? { cached_input_tokens: cachedInputTokens } : undefined), duration_ms: durationMs, }); return response; }; } /** * Creates a collector that accumulates sampling call data during tool execution. * Use with `wrapSamplingHandler` to capture all sampling calls for a tool invocation. * * @example * ```ts * const collector = createSamplingCollector(); * const wrappedHandler = wrapSamplingHandler(handler, collector.collect); * // ... execute MCP tool ... * const calls = collector.getCalls(); // SamplingCallData[] * ``` */ export function createSamplingCollector() { const calls: SamplingCallData[] = []; return { collect: (data: SamplingCallData) => calls.push(data), getCalls: () => [...calls], reset: () => { calls.length = 0; }, }; }
